Dental care pricing isn't one-size-fits-all. What you pay usually depends on the complexity of your specific needs, the materials selected for crowns or fillings, and whether you require specialized equipment or sedation. If you have insurance, that plays a massive role in your out-of-pocket responsibility. Without coverage, fees reflect the time and expertise required for your procedure. A dentist is a medical professional focused on the health of your teeth, gums, and mouth. They diagnose, treat, and prevent oral diseases and conditions. This includes everything from routine cleanings to more complex restorative work. The licensed pros you'll speak with are experts in oral care.
Wisdom teeth are often the most challenging to extract, particularly if they are impacted or have unusual root formations. This can require surgical intervention. If you're in Fort Wayne and need an extraction, the pros can assess the difficulty.
